ERC Training Operations & Analytics Specialist

Job description

Job Description Summary



#LI-Hybrid
Location: Hyderabad, India
Relocation Support: This role is based in Hyderabad, India. Novartis is unable to offer relocation support: please only apply if accessible.
Imagine turning complex training data into insights that strengthen ethics, compliance, and decision-making across a global organization. As an ERC Training - Program Operations & Analytics Specialist, you will play a key role in shaping learning outcomes by transforming data into action, driving operational excellence, and supporting impactful training programs that reach associates worldwide. Working closely with global stakeholders, you will combine analytics, project management, and learning operations expertise to help deliver high-quality training solutions while contributing to Novartis' mission to reimagine medicine and improve patients' lives.

Job Description



Key Responsibilities
•    Deliver operational support for global and local ethics, risk and compliance training programs.
•    Transform training data into actionable insights that inform decision-making and drive program improvements.
•    Monitor training completion, coordinate follow-ups and ensure accurate compliance reporting.
•    Manage project plans, action trackers, milestones and deliverables across multiple initiatives.
•    Coordinate meetings, webinars and training activities while maintaining central program calendars.
•    Partner with course owners to develop engaging global and targeted learning solutions.
•    Leverage artificial intelligence tools to improve efficiency, content generation and data-driven decision-making.




Essential Requirements
•    Bachelor's degree in Data Science, Computer Science, Information Technology or a related field.
•    Minimum three years' experience in data analytics, information management and project delivery.
•    Strong experience with analytics and business intelligence tools, including dashboard development.
•    Advanced Microsoft Excel and PowerPoint skills for data analysis and insight-driven storytelling.
•    Working knowledge of project management methodologies, including Agile, Waterfall and hybrid approaches.
•    Experience using learning management systems and human resources platforms to manage training data.
•    Proven ability to collaborate effectively across global, cross-functional teams and stakeholders.
•    Excellent written and verbal communication skills with the ability to simplify complex concepts.
